Abstract

In today's competitive business landscape, marketing strategies play a pivotal role in shaping purchasing
decisions within the construction materials sector. This article examine the impact of marketing strategies on the
buying behavior of ready-mix concrete manufacturers, with a focus on their interactions with the cement industry.
By analysing various marketing tactics and their impact on supplier-customer relationships, this study contributes
valuable insights that can inform strategic decision-making and enhance the effectiveness of marketing efforts
within the construction materials sector. By leveraging the power of artificial intelligence, we aim to optimize
route planning, scheduling and resource allocation, thereby contributing to the construction industry's efficiency
and sustainability. The delivery of ready-mixed concrete is a cornerstone of efficient and effective construction
projects. By understanding the components, processes, benefits, challenges and best practices associated with
ready-mixed concrete delivery, construction professionals can ensure the successful execution of projects while
maintaining the highest standards of quality and efficiency.
